Wetland Downpour
Wetland Downpour is a loop-exclusive stage variant for Wetland Aspect with a lush, jungle-y theme and heavy rain. There aren't any new areas, but there are a few new random variations, some of which can drastically change a significant portion of the map.

Features
Gameplay Changes (compared to Wetland Aspect)
- Updated enemy spawn pools (Added Alloy Vultures and Grovetenders. Added Larvae and Solus Amalgamator after looping. Removed Beetles and Beetle Queen)
- Updated interactable pools (Drone scrappers can appear. Drone combiners can appear after looping)
- Added ~6 new random variations
- Removed the random variations where a stone gate rises up to block a shortcut into a corner
- Replaced/re-arranged all pillars, logs and other clutter throughout the map
- Added a third body of water
- The map is very slightly smaller overall
Visual Changes
- There are now several distinct areas scattered throughout the map: an abandoned survivor camp, a flooded altar, dormant Lynx Totems, etc.
- Terrain textures are more saturated and the map is generally much more lush, with new mangrove trees, grass patches, and underwater foliage
- The giant shallow "lake" is now deep enough to completely submerge all non-modded survivors
- Water is clearer to make chests and other interactables more visible. Underwater post processing is a bit more noticeable
- Ground terrain now has more height variation, mostly to make transitions between dry ground and water look more natural
- The map is foggier and darker
Config Options
- Loop Variant (default true): If true, functions like a vanilla post-loop stage (does not appear before looping, replaces Wetland Aspect after looping). If false, it never replaces Wetland Aspect and can appear at any time, like a normal stage
- Replace Wetland Aspect (default false): If true, always replaces Wetland Aspect, before and after looping, regardless of what value Loop Variant is set to
